FP+ booking question (21 day ticket)

Hi

Today is our day to book FP+ (60 days out as we're staying onsite). We have 21 day tickets and our reservation is from 2-17 November. I have been able to book fast passes for all of the days apart from the 17th - it won't let me select this date at all (in the app or the web desktop version). I've called disney twice...

-The first time the lady said remove the app from my system, wait 15 minutes and log back in. Even though I'd already done this, I tried again. It didn't work.

-The second time the lady said it was because I can only book 14 days worth of tickets at a time and once we've used our fast passes on day 1 in Florida we'll be able to book more. After putting the phone down I checked and I was able to book for 15 days (we originally had a rest days I didn't book any). When we had 21 day tickets last year we could book them all at once. Exactly the same tickets from Disney.

Can anybody help please before I call them back again? Have they changed the restrictions for 21 day tickets?

When I did ours I booked 14 days straight away and then booked on a day by day basis if that makes sense. For instance if I booked 14 days today I could go on tomorrow and book another day, and so on. Maybe someone can correct me if I am wrong though.

Ours was just as Lyn1 said. We could book 14 days at 60-day mark, then every day we could book one day at a time for the third week. We are same as you - 21 day tickets.

Last year they were "honouring" the length of stay but this year it specifically says for length of stay up to 14 days, we had no problem getting the 2 extra days one day at a time.
